Head of State Bajram Begaj welcomed artists from the Tetova High School to the Presidency today. During the meeting, Begaj encouraged the artists to continue preserving and promoting Albanian tradition.

“A piece of art” arrived this Friday from Tetovo, in Tirana. The President of the Republic, Sh. TZ Bajram Begaj, opened the doors of the institution to the young artists of the municipal textile high school in Tetovo. They revealed their talent through creations inspired by tradition. The 63 works exhibited at the Presidency Institution conveyed a variety of avant-garde artistic currents in textiles, furniture and interiors with the common element: Albanianness.

President Begaj, in welcoming them, described them as missionaries in the continuation of preserving the spirit of the nation, promoters of cultural and educational values.

"Your vocational school has a tradition of several years in the design of various clothing, applied arts of interior, furniture and handicraft and food products, and this is a model that deserves pan-Albanian, nationwide promotion. Today, I have also invited students of the same direction as you from the Artistic Lyceum of Tirana, so that both schools can build bridges of cooperation, which are based on the development of youth talents in art and textiles. The Head of State advised the young artists to continue preserving and promoting the tradition: "I encourage you, dear students, that your artistic imagination never abandons the national elements and the artistic spirit of Albanians poured over the centuries into our traditional clothing. They are clothing of our national and cultural identity, inherited and enriched from generation to generation," the presidency's announcement states.

Begaj emphasized that we must work hard so that, in addition to the "K'cim of Tropoja", thousands of years of traditional clothing are also included in UNESCO.

"Referring to the Xhubleta and Tropoja Dance protected by UNESCO, President Begaj said: "We must continue to work hard so that our thousand-year-old costumes from other regions of Albania can also be transformed into the wealth of all humanity."

The Mayor of Tetova, Bilall Kasami, was also present at this event, who praised the initiative of the President of the Republic in the service of Albanianness: "With this action, the President also demonstrates in action his commitment to the Constitution of Albania to be the President of all Albanians and outside other ethnic lands."

"Students and teachers from Tetovo exchanged ideas with artists and professors from the Tirana Artistic Lyceum on creating the possibility of institutionalizing the union of young people in Albanian territories," the presidency announced.
